The Toyota Yaris is a better choice in terms of fuel economy based on user-reported consumption, although the specification shows otherwise. By specification Toyota Yaris consumes 0.1 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Toyota Auris, which means that if you drive 15,000 km in a year, the Toyota Yaris could require 15 litres more fuel. But when we compare the real fuel consumption reported by users, Toyota Yaris consumes 0.5 litres less fuel per 100 km than the Toyota Auris. | |||

Toyota Yaris is smaller, but slightly higher. Toyota Yaris is 47 cm shorter than the Toyota Auris, 6 cm narrower, while the height of Toyota Yaris is 1 cm higher. | |||

The turning circle of the Toyota Yaris is 1 metres less than that of the Toyota Auris, which means Toyota Yaris can be easier to manoeuvre in tight streets and parking spaces. | |||
